We rejoice with you and give thanks to God for the continued victory He is giving you over intrusive thoughts and OCD, and for how He is causing your love for the church to grow. This is evidence of His grace at work in you and we praise Him together for it.

We know how distressing and exhausting intrusive thoughts can be, but we are reminded that God has not given us a spirit of fear, but of power, love, and self-control 2 Timothy 1:7. The battle is often in the mind, and God calls us to bring every thought into captivity to the obedience of Christ 2 Corinthians 10:5 and to be transformed by the renewing of our minds Romans 12:2. He promises perfect peace to those whose minds are steadfast because they trust in Him Isaiah 26:3.

We also rejoice that your love for the church is growing, for this is the family of God and the body of Christ. We are exhorted not to forsake our own assembling together, as is the habit of some, but to exhort one another Hebrews 10:25, and it is beautiful to see the Lord knitting your heart more deeply to His people. Continue to press into fellowship, into the Word, and into prayer, for there we find encouragement, accountability, and the reminder that we are not alone in our struggles.

We're thankful you came back to update us. It is encouraging to hear about the victory you've been experiencing and that your love for the church is growing even in the middle of this struggle. We are glad to keep standing with you in prayer.

We know intrusive thoughts can be wearying. They often feel persistent and unwanted, and it makes sense they would stir up anxiety even when they don't reflect your heart or what you want. Please don't hear that struggle as a measure of your faith. Growth often happens step by step, and staying connected to the church the way you are is a good place to keep receiving encouragement and grounding.

If you haven't already, it may help to share openly with a trusted pastor or counselor in your church about what you're experiencing, so someone who knows you can walk with you week to week. And alongside prayer, we gently encourage you to reach out to a counselor or medical professional for support with what you're describing if that would be helpful. You don't have to sort through this alone.

You speak of intrusive thoughts and the burden of OCD, and the multitude of thoughts within. Do not wonder that such thoughts assail you. Intruding thoughts surround us like a plague of flies, they are here, there, and everywhere, and it costs infinite pains to drive them away. Even when we would offer our hearts to God, ravenous birds will come down upon the sacrifice. In this our weakness is complete, and therefore we have need that God Himself should prepare our hearts.

Remember what is written, For My thoughts are not your thoughts, neither are your ways My ways, says the Lord. For as the heavens are higher than the earth, so are My ways higher than your ways and My thoughts than your thoughts. Your thoughts in this struggle may be tumultuous and distressing, but His thoughts concerning you are constant, kind, wise, tender and gracious. How precious also are Your thoughts unto me, O God, how great is the sum of them. When the multitude of thoughts within you rises, hear His word again, In the multitude of my thoughts within me Your comforts delight my soul. His comforts are equal to your multitude.

And here is your war cry and your hope, that Jesus wins the victory, but He will not enjoy it alone, He will glorify His people. Because He poured out His soul unto death, Satan's power is broken and the Seed of the woman shall trample on the serpent. It was by the mighty power of the Holy Spirit dwelling in Him that Jesus overcame the world, and that same quiet power, if it dwells in us, will make us win the same victory by faith. When Jesus Christ the Head of the Church was victorious over the foe, every member of His mystical Body, even the most uncomely, was virtually a conqueror in the conquering Head. So you are more than conqueror through Him that loved you. Your victory is not wrought by the strength of your own mind, but by His finished work.

Therefore cultivate with us those thoughts which bear good fruit. Cultivate thankful thoughts, for the fruit of thankful thoughts will be summer in your soul even when it is winter outside. Get many and abundant believing thoughts, laying hold on God's thoughts by faith rather than your own. And seek to have many longing thoughts after Christ, let Him have the best thoughts, the cream of them, the first growth of your spirit. When intrusive thoughts come, bring them at once to Him in lowliness of heart, for low thoughts of ourselves are the companions of prevailing prayers, and He who has had love enough to prepare your heart to pray has grace enough to give you the blessing.
